#USERID - Authentication User ID

SELINT 2

AT#USERID=
[<user>]

Set command sets the user identification string to be used during the
authentication step.

Parameter:
<user> - string type, it’s the authentication User Id; the max length for this

value is the output of Test command, AT#USERID=? (factory
default is the empty string “”).


Note: this command is not allowed for sockets associated to a GSM context
(see #SCFG).

AT#USERID?

Read command reports the current user identification string, in the format:

#USERID: <user>

AT#USERID=?

Test command returns the maximum allowed length of the string parameter
<user>.

Example

AT#USERID="myName"

OK
AT#USERID?
#USERID: "myName"


OK

3.5.7.5.2 Authentication Password - #PASSW

#PASSW - Authentication Password

SELINT 0/1

AT#PASSW=
<pwd>

Set command sets the user password string to be used during the
authentication step.

Parameter:
<pwd> - string type, it’s the authentication password; the max length for this

value is the output of Test command, AT#PASSW=? (factory
default is the empty string “”).

AT#PASSW=?

Test command returns the maximum allowed length of the string parameter
<pwd>.

Example

AT#PASSW="myPassword"
